About This Item
Toronto: William Collins Sons & Co., 1964. Book. Very Good +. Hardcover. 1st Edition. About Fine But For Prev. Owner Name On Front End Paper, And A Little Bumping To Spine Ends. Internally Tight And Clean. The Price-Clipped Jacket Is Just Very Good, With Edge Wear And Closed Tears, Splitting To Front Flap Fold, And Sunning To Spine. .
